🌿 NELLIGEN FOLK FESTIVAL 🌿
📍 The Steampacket Hotel, Nelligen
🗓 Easter Long Weekend — Saturday 4th April
⏰ 3:00pm – 9:30pm
🎶 Original Folk • Storytellers • South Coast & Beyond
Settle in for an afternoon and evening of authentic, heart-led folk music as The Steampacket Hotel hosts the Nelligen Folk Festival — a celebration of song, story and connection this Easter long weekend.
From coastal troubadours to cinematic alt-folk storytellers, this carefully curated lineup brings together some of the most compelling original artists from the South Coast and across Australia.
✨ Kicking things off | Kane Calcite
Earthy, emotive and deeply connected to place, Kane Calcite opens the festival with smooth acoustic textures and vulnerable storytelling. Drawing inspiration from the ocean, nature and human connection, Kane’s performances are both powerful and intimate. Having shared stages with Jack Botts, Kim Churchill, Ash Grunwald and more, Kane sets the tone beautifully for the day ahead.
✨ Mark Howard
Phillip Island troubadour Mark Howard brings dusk-lit songs shaped by decades of travel and forty-five countries’ worth of stages. His cinematic blend of alt-rock, folk blues and alt-country is anchored by a swampy groove and a voice that sounds like it’s lived a few lives. With AMRAP No.1 singles, ABC Radio play and festival appearances from Edinburgh to Adelaide Fringe, Mark is a magnetic storyteller not to be missed.
✨ JC and the Tree
Hailing from the Sunshine Coast, JC and the Tree offer a rich folk-rock fusion inspired by nature and crafted with intention. Featuring soaring violin, lush harmonies, piano and hand-built acoustic guitars, their sound is intricate yet accessible. With appearances at Woodford Folk Festival, Caloundra Music Fest and beyond, this duo takes audiences on a genre-spanning journey that is both grounded and transcendent.
✨ Blue Mallee
Genre-bending and cinematic, Blue Mallee fuse indie rock, ambient textures and traditional folk roots. Known for their roaring vocals, poetic grit and generous wit, their live shows are part concert, part storytelling. With festival appearances across NSW and supports alongside The Black Sorrows and Ash Grunwald, Blue Mallee bring warmth, humour and depth to the stage.
🔥 Closing the night | Jack Raymond
Rugged, raw and deeply grounded, Jack Raymond closes the festival with his signature “mountain roots” sound. Inspired by the landscapes of regional Victoria, his blues-tinged folk songs crackle with emotion and storytelling, delivered through a voice as textured as gravel roads and campfire embers.
